Write the equation for a parabola with a focus at (6,-4) and a directrix at y= -7

Answers

Given:

The focus of the parabola is at (6,-4).

Directrix at y=-7.

To find:

The equation of the parabola.

Solution:

The general equation of a parabola is:

[tex]y=\dfrac{1}{4p}(x-h)^2+k[/tex]                  ...(i)

Where, (h,k) is vertex, (h,k+p) is the focus and y=k-p is the directrix.

The focus of the parabola is at (6,-4).

[tex](h,k+p)=(6,-4)[/tex]

On comparing both sides, we get

[tex]h=6[/tex]

[tex]k+p=-4[/tex]                            ...(ii)

Directrix at y=-7. So,

[tex]k-p=-7[/tex]                            ...(iii)

Adding (ii) and (iii), we get

[tex]2k=-11[/tex]

[tex]k=\dfrac{-11}{2}[/tex]

[tex]k=-5.5[/tex]

Putting [tex]k=-5.5[/tex] in (ii), we get

[tex]-5.5+p=-4[/tex]

[tex]p=-4+5.5[/tex]

[tex]p=1.5[/tex]

Putting [tex]h=6, k=-5.5,p=1.5[/tex] in (i), we get

[tex]y=\dfrac{1}{4(1.5)}(x-6)^2+(-5.5)[/tex]

[tex]y=\dfrac{1}{6}(x-6)^2-5.5[/tex]

Therefore, the equation of the parabola is [tex]y=\dfrac{1}{6}(x-6)^2-5.5[/tex].

Integrate with respect to x

1/√(1-2x)

Answers

Answer:

-√(1 - 2x) + C

Step-by-step explanation:

1/√(1-2x)

We want to integrate it. Thus;

∫1/√(1 - 2x) dx

Let u = 1 - 2x

Thus;

du/dx = -2

Thus, dx = -½du

Thus,we now have;

-½∫1/√(u) du

By application of power rule, we will now have;

-½∫1/√(u) du = -√(u) + C

Plugging in the value of u, we will have;

-√(1 - 2x) + C
